如何用matlab進(jìn)行不動(dòng)點(diǎn)迭代計(jì)算 matlab牛頓迭代法求根例題?
matlab牛頓迭代法求根例題?下面是一個(gè)用MATLAB求解方程的牛頓迭代法的例子:假設(shè)我們想解下面的方程:x^3-2*x-50首先,我們需要計(jì)算方程的導(dǎo)數(shù):f(x)3*x^2-2接下來(lái),我們可以使用
matlab牛頓迭代法求根例題?
下面是一個(gè)用MATLAB求解方程的牛頓迭代法的例子:
假設(shè)我們想解下面的方程:
x^3-2*x-50
首先,我們需要計(jì)算方程的導(dǎo)數(shù):
f(x)3*x^2-2
接下來(lái),我們可以使用下面的MATLAB代碼來(lái)求解這個(gè)方程:
%定義了函數(shù)f(x)
f @(x)x^3-2 * x-5;
%定義了函數(shù)f(x)
f _ prim
matlab怎么運(yùn)行代碼?
在編輯器或?qū)崟r(shí)編輯器選項(xiàng)卡的部分中,選擇運(yùn)行并轉(zhuǎn)發(fā)。運(yùn)行選定部分中的代碼,然后運(yùn)行選定部分之后的所有代碼。在編輯器或?qū)崟r(shí)編輯器選項(xiàng)卡的部分中,選擇運(yùn)行到終點(diǎn)。運(yùn)行到特定的代碼行并暫停。
MATLAB將用于迭代分析和設(shè)計(jì)過(guò)程調(diào)整的桌面環(huán)境與用于直接表達(dá)矩陣和數(shù)組數(shù)學(xué)的編程語(yǔ)言相結(jié)合。
matlab如何寫(xiě)入步長(zhǎng)區(qū)間?
初始化時(shí)定義變量st
橢圓樓梯做法?
結(jié)合工程實(shí)踐,介紹了橢圓螺旋樓梯的微分幾何數(shù)學(xué)模型,闡述了樓梯施工放樣的基本方法,即根據(jù)已知兩端的參數(shù)將橢圓弧長(zhǎng)等分成若干等份。
橢圓弧長(zhǎng)積分的結(jié)果不能用解析解明確表示。用泰勒級(jí)數(shù)導(dǎo)出弧長(zhǎng)積分的近似解析解,然后用New-ton迭代法手算出各弧長(zhǎng)平分線對(duì)應(yīng)的參數(shù)t,從而得到橢圓螺旋樓梯各控制點(diǎn)的坐標(biāo)。同時(shí)用Matlab軟件編程計(jì)算進(jìn)行驗(yàn)證。比較手工計(jì)算和計(jì)算機(jī)計(jì)算的結(jié)果,發(fā)現(xiàn)解析解完全滿足工程設(shè)計(jì)的要求。
該方法也可用于其他的旋轉(zhuǎn)樓梯施工放樣。